(c)Deciding whether to take harmonic suppression measures
When the outgoing harmonic current > the maximum value per 1kW contract  contract kW, a harmonic suppression
measures are required.

Harmonic current is suppressed by installing an AC reactor (FR-HAL) in the AC input side of the inverter
or a DC reactor (FR-HEL) in the DC bus line of the inverter, or by installing both.
FR-HC2 is designed to switch ON/OFF the converter circuit to convert an input current waveform into a
sine wave, suppressing the harmonic current considerably. The converter (FR-HC2) is used with the
standard-equipped peripheral devices and accessories.
Using the power factor improving static capacitor with a series reactor has an effect of absorbing
harmonic currents.
Using two transformers with a phase angle difference of 30 as in
provides an effect corresponding to 12 pulses and reduces low-degree harmonic currents.
A capacitor and a reactor are used together to reduce impedance at specific frequencies, producing a
great effect of absorbing harmonic currents.
This filter detects the current of the circuit, where harmonic current is generated, and generates the
harmonic current equivalent to the difference between that current and a fundamental wave current.
By doing so, the harmonic current at where it was detected can be suppressed, and great absorption of
harmonic current can be expected.
